This long established and highly respected course with a team of Deaf and hearing staff from diverse backgrounds . It is one of the few courses of its kind in British Sign Language (Interpreting) in the UK. The award offers the potential to lead to RSLI or Trainee interpreter status recognised by the professional registration body - the NRCPD (see website). An opportunity for practical application of learning through a well-established work placement component in the final year. To date, upon graduation, students have found a high level of employability success. An opportunity to explore deaf blindness as part of your studies. The lecturing team have a variety of national and international expertise in teaching and professional qualifications and have experience working for a diverse range of public, private and voluntary sector organisations. Access to technology support for filming of 'live assessment' - use of filming studio, editing suite, as well as other situated learning environments. The team believes in interactive learning and encourages full participation from all our students: external examiners have consistently highlighted our innovative learning, teaching and assessments regimes as a major strength.Within the context of the University’s mission statement and its commitment to widening participation and equal opportunities, responsiveness to local, regional and national needs, curriculum innovation and continuing quality enhancement, the programme aims to: 1. Apply conceptual, theoretical and vocational knowledge of BSL to the study of Deaf people and their language. 2. Demonstrate knowledge and understanding of Deaf issues within a wider context. 3. Develop interpersonal skills in a bilingual environment and gain/demonstrate an awareness of the impact of the interpreter upon the communities they serve. 4. Evidence knowledge of interpreting ethics and protocol in a number of interpreting settings. 5. Graduate individuals to work cohesively in an interpreting environment in accordance with the national interpreting registration standards (NIRS)/National Occupational Standards for interpreting (NOSI). 6. Sustain and foster the enjoyment of lifelong learning within the professional development of individual interpreters.
